I'm in the proccess of renovating my room, and i would love to have a little indoor pond. maybe like 400 gallons. but ive read that the eveporation can cause mold/mildew issues, and other things. so i was wondering if i could just get a de-humidifier and put it in the room?
 
Heat exchanger if you can afford it.Dehumidifyer is going to have to work too hard with an open pond.
 
I have seen a lot of luck with bathroom fans installed that are hooked up to de-humidastats. They are more efficient than dehumidifiers, and will get the job done.
